About Chunmu Feng
Chunmu Feng is a scholar working on Condensed Matter Physics,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and Inorganic Chemistry, having authored 64 papers that have together received 2.7k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Iron-based superconductors research (38 papers), Rare-earth and actinide compounds (28 papers) and Physics of Superconductivity and Magnetism (25 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Condensed Matter Physics (1.8k citations),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(2.3k citations) and Accounting (399 citations). Chunmu Feng has collaborated with scholars based in China, Japan and Israel. Frequent co-authors include Guang‐Han Cao, Zhu‐An Xu, Shuai Jiang, Cao Wang, Tao Qian, Jianhui Dai, Minghu Fang, Huiqiu Yuan, Jin‐Ke Bao and Chiheng Dong.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Physical Review Letters and Physical review. B, Condensed matter.
